In this minisymposium we aim to gather recent progress on the bifurcation of nonlinear waves in various systems, from neuroscience, optimal control, multi-physics and ecology.
On the theoretical side we think of analytical results beyond simple Turing bifurcations in reaction–diffusion systems, for instance Turing-Hopf interactions, modulated traveling waves, non-local couplings, bifurcation in optimal control. Regarding applications we mainly aim at “non-standard” systems in neuroscience, ecology and economics, optics and fluids. Besides theory and applications we plan a few talks on new numerical methods and toolboxes for bifurcation analysis.
